What is a Part Time Nurse RN?

A Part Time Nurse RN is a Registered Nurse who works fewer hours than a full-time nurse, typically less than 30-36 hours per week. Part time RNs perform the same duties as full-time nurses, such as assessing patients, administering medication, and collaborating with healthcare teams. This role is ideal for those who need flexible schedules, such as students, parents, or semi-retired nurses. Part time nurses may work in hospitals, clinics, nursing homes, or other healthcare settings.

What are some common scheduling challenges faced by part-time RN nurses, and how can they be managed?

Part-time RN nurses often navigate variable schedules, which can sometimes lead to inconsistent shift assignments or last-minute changes. This can be challenging when balancing work with personal commitments or other jobs. To manage these challenges, it's helpful to communicate availability clearly with supervisors, be proactive in shift planning, and utilize any available scheduling software or tools provided by the employer. Many healthcare facilities also offer self-scheduling options or shift-swapping systems to increase flexibility and work-life balance.
